On Tuesday, Feb. 18, former Little Miami High School standout Kaylie Noell’s current college team, the Delaware State Hornets, won 13-3 in their NCAA Division I softball game against the Virginia Union Panthers.

The game took place at DSU Softball Field. This was their second matchup against the Panthers this season.

The Hornets’ next game is scheduled for Saturday, Feb. 22 at 2 p.m. at DSU Softball Field against Bucknell Bison.
